Please pardon my ignorance in this area of law, but...
When a company files under California state law a "general assignment"
for the benefit of creditors (a type of liquidation, similar to a
liquidation administered under Chapter 7 of the Bankruptcy Code), where
is that proceeding filed? Is it filed in the county court system as a
civil matter, or is there a special administrative or judicial venue for
the filing of general assignments?
